10 tips to save on your car rental in and around Hudson Falls Historic District

  1. Use filters to find the right car: Refine your search by selecting vehicle types and specific features. Whether you require an SUV for extra room, a convertible for summer drives, or a compact car for budget-friendly travel, utilize the filters on Expedia to discover the best fit for your journey.
  2. Book in advance to help lower costs: Rental rates can vary based on demand, so it's advisable to secure your car well ahead of your trip. By booking early, you’re more likely to lock in lower prices and enjoy better availability, especially during peak travel seasons.
  3. Consider a smaller car for savings: Compact cars are typically more affordable to rent and easier to maneuver in crowded areas. Mid-size rentals strike a good balance between cost, comfort, and fuel efficiency.
  4. Age guidelines: Drivers under 30 may encounter higher deposits or daily fees, and certain vehicle categories—such as SUVs or luxury models—might be restricted. This also applies to renters over 70 years old. Always verify the age requirements before making a reservation.
  5. Check fuel policies: Some rental agreements stipulate a full-to-full fuel policy, meaning you must return the car with a full tank to avoid additional fees. This is generally the most advantageous option. Other policies may include full-to-empty or prepaid fuel options, which are acceptable as well. Just ensure you return the vehicle empty in those cases.
  6. Save on city and airport pickups: Picking up your rental car at airports often incurs a surcharge, but the convenience may justify the extra cost.
  7. Know your payment options: Most car rental companies exclusively accept credit cards for payment.
  8. Understand your insurance coverage: Car rental insurance can help you avoid unexpected expenses and provides peace of mind in case of unforeseen events during your trip. Adding insurance is simple when you book through Expedia.
  9. Consider unlimited mileage: If you plan on taking long road trips, seek out rentals that offer unlimited mileage to prevent additional charges.
  10. Bring your driver's license and ID: A valid driver's license is necessary to rent a car.

Best time to rent a car in and around Hudson Falls Historic District

The best time to rent a car in and around Hudson Falls Historic District is March, when prices are at their lowest and demand is moderately low. January and February also offer good value with slightly low prices and less competition. April and May remain moderate, with average pricing and demand. In contrast, August tends to be the most expensive month, with higher demand as summer peaks. June and July follow closely behind, showing slightly high prices and moderately high demand.
